It integrates key components such as battery packs, Battery Management Systems (BMS), energy storage inverters (PCS), and Energy Management Systems (EMS) into a standardized container, forming a plug-and-play energy storage unit. . A Containerized Energy-Storage System, or CESS, is an innovative energy storage solution packaged within a modular, transportable container. Power station energy storage charging and discharging process
These devices store energy electrochemically, wherein chemical reactions take place during both the charging and discharging processes. When charging, energy is supplied, causing lithium ions to move from the cathode to the anode, effectively storing energy. . Battery storage is a technology that enables power system operators and utilities to store energy for later use. A battery energy storage system (BESS) is an electrochemical device that charges (or collects energy) from the grid or a power plant and then discharges that energy at a later time to. .
